EAFB Boat Operations. (Eglin Air Force Base)
Ground-based navigation and electronic devices or smart phone apps that rely on GPS may be affected in the Eglin Air Force Base vicinity while tests are conducted from 8 a.m. to 2 p.m. local time.
Normal GPS reliability will resume once testing is complete each day. Those in the area are strongly encouraged to plan activities accordingly.
Each day, fighter aircraft will release munitions between 8 a.m. and 2 p.m. approximately 20 nautical miles south of Destin over the Gulf of Mexico. The test will be conducted within a cleared range safety area, which includes boat surveillance. Notices to mariners will be issued prior to missions and flyers will be handed out at the local marina.
These operations are part of the 53rd Wing’s Weapon System Evaluation Program. For more information, call the Team Eglin public affairs office at 882-3931 or the 53rd Wing public affairs office at 882-0423.
